Investigating Distinct Window Covering Styles: Louvered, Paneled, and Board-and-Batten

Shutters come in diverse looks, each supplying a distinct visual appeal to your property’s external. Here are the three principal styles of window shutters:

1. Louvered Shutters: Louvered shutters feature horizontal slats that are angled to allow airflow and light control. These shutters add a touch of elegance and sophistication to any home and are commonly seen in coastal or cottage-style residences.

2. Paneled Shutters: Paneled shutters have a solid construction, with vertical panels that add a sense of stability and substance to the windows. They are a classic choice that complements traditional and colonial-style homes.

3. Board-and-Batten Shutters: Board-and-batten shutters consist of vertical boards held together with crosspieces (battens). This rustic and charming style suits farmhouse and country-style homes.

Each shutter style brings a distinctive look to your residence’s facade, so decide on one that aligns with your architectural and design preferences and aesthetic aesthetic.

Customizing Window Shutters for Your Special Windows

No two windows are precisely the very same, and that’s where the elegance of tailor-made window shutters comes in. Adaptation enables you to have shutters designed to fit the specific measurements and details of your windows. Here are some ways to tailor your window shutters:

1. Size and Shape: Whether you have standard rectangular windows or specialty-shaped ones like arches or circles, custom shutters can be designed to perfectly fit your windows.

2. Material: Window shutters can be crafted from various materials, such as wood, vinyl, or composite. Each material offers different benefits in terms of durability, appearance, and maintenance.

3. Color and Finish: Customize the color and finish of your shutters to complement the overall exterior color scheme of your home. Consider opting for a finish that enhances the natural grain of wood or a bold paint color to make a statement.

4. Operability: If you opt for operable shutters, you can choose between different types of hardware and mechanisms to open and close the shutters as needed.

Tailoring your window shutters ensures a smooth and tailored look that enhances the entire aesthetics of your home.

Interior against. Exterior Shutters: Advantages and Disadvantages

Both interior and outside shutters offer their own array of advantages and are ideal for various uses. Understanding their pros and cons can assist you decide which variety is superior for your home.

Interior Shutters:
Advantages: Inside shutters provide impressive brightness control, seclusion, and insulation. They are uncomplicated to wash and preserve and can be a trendy addition to your inside design.
Cons: Inside shutters are not as successful at shielding your windows from the elements, and they don’t offer the same extent of security as exterior shutters.

Outdoor Shutters:
Advantages: Outdoor shutters supply additional protection against severe weather conditions, offer enhanced security, and can enhance the curb appeal of your home.
Cons: Outdoor shutters require more maintenance and are generally more expensive than their interior counterparts.

Finally, the option between interior and exterior shutters depends on your particular needs and preferences.

Enhancing Curb Appeal with Colored or Stained Shutters

One of the simplest and most successful ways to boost your home’s curb appeal is by deciding on the right finish for your shutters. Both paint and stain supply distinct results, allowing you to obtain a look that suits your taste and style.

Painted Shutters: Painting your shutters can provide a clean and polished appearance. Opt for classic colors like white or black for a timeless look, or choose bold hues to add a pop of color to your home’s facade.

Stained Shutters: Staining your shutters enhances the natural beauty of the wood and adds warmth to your exterior. Stains come in various shades, from light to dark, allowing you to achieve a look that complements your home’s architectural style.

Whether you prefer the crispness of painted shutters or the warmth of stained shutters, both options can significantly impact your home’s entire curb appeal.
